Benefits of Fig Milk:

1. Nutritional Powerhouse:

Fig milk is rich in essential v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ants, including calcium, potassium, iron, and vitamins A and K. These nutrients support overall health and well-being.

2. Digestive Health: 

Fig milk possesses natural laxative properties, aiding in relieving constipation and promoting regular bowel movements. It also helps maintain a healthy gut by promoting the growth of beneficial gut bacteria.

Benefits of Fig Milk:

3. Bone Health: 

The high calcium content in fig milk contributes to maintaining healthy bones and preventing conditions such as osteoporosis.

4. Cardiovascular Health: 

The presence of potassium in fig milk helps regulate blood pressure and maintain heart health. Additionally, the antioxidants in figs may help reduce oxidative stress and lower the risk of cardiovascular diseases.

Apricot Dry Fruit, Khubani Health Benefits

khushk khubani health benefitsKhubani (Dry apricot) is one of the highly nutrient dry fruit. Apricot dried fruit is commonly known as khushak khubani, qubani,khurmani  or sukhi khubani in Urdu and Hindi and scientifically referred to as Prunus armeniaca, is closely related to plums. Khubani or apricot is good source of Potassium, Calcium, Phosphorus, Vitamin C, Iron, and Vitamin A.  It is acquired from drying sparkling orange or yellowish coloured apricot. Water content material of the fruit is evaporated without harming nutritive value of the apricots. There are two technique followed in evaporation of water one is natural and different is conventional. Organic fruit is taken into consideration extra useful. There are many famous delicacies are related to this fruit e.G Khubani ka Meetha (Indian and Pakistani Hyderabadi delicacies).

Side effects of eating dry Khubani or Apricot

Khubani or apricot has no side effects or any facet consequences of eating apricot in natural way however some people have would possibly hypersensitivity from fruit. On the opposite, there is some problem approximately dried fruit. Sulphites are used some time drying the fruit, and that isn't a good for fitness Sulphites can seriously induce asthmatic attacks and reason asthma. Therefore, as an asthma medicine, use natural dried apricots need to be used.

Apricot in Pregnancy
Apricot during pregnancy

During pregnancy from time to time you start  cravings for healthy food and snacks, and dried apricots are a healthy option for you when you want a food boost. Pregnant women are encouraged to up their iron intake to make sure. A handful of dried apricots provides round 10% of your daily iron intake, along with a good quantity of copper and cobalt. They additionally contain some vitamins consisting of folic acid, potassium, calcium and magnesium - all which assist to maintain you strong all through pregnancy. One ordinary pregnancy problem is having digestive issues - dried apricots assist to regulate this method and save you your bowels from becoming steady as baby develops. Eating an excess of apricots can lead to gastric upset, so make certain you consume them in moderation.
